Transaction ec805ca123517a4b8614d70b2dc58e201c86c796f918767c0ea5c84c5983d8b5
1 Input
1 Output
-
ec805ca123517a4b8614d70b2dc58e201c86c796f918767c0ea5c84c5983d8b5:0
- value
- 35653
- script pubkey
- OP_0 OP_PUSHBYTES_32 9712937d520a738f601e073c6a174d8e6f036f626966b51beb7c98ec4f9cdbb7
- address
- bc1qjuffxl2jpfec7cq7qu7x596d3ehsxmmzd9nt2xlt0jvwcnuumwmsasphja